Brodie Lee was known by many as a really good guy who helped many in their wrestling career and friend to many. His passing was devastating and is still affecting the wrestling industry today from the Dark Order to JR announcing each show with you know that means. There are still a lot of tributes to the late, great Brodie Lee.
However, it seems like he was one of the reasons why AEW signed Malakie Black. Malakai Black was in WWE before signing with AEW under the name Aleister Black at the same time, Brodie Lee was a wrestler in WWE under the name Luke Harper.
